I just want to resurrect this thread for anyone searching in the future, wanting to know about the Stage 4 HA73/88 keybed. I have the HA73 as well as a stage 3 88. At first I thought the Stage 4 was the same feel as the Stage 3 88. But I was away from my Stage 3 for 6 weeks. When I got back, having only played the Stage 4 HA73 in that time, the Stage 3 felt very much inferior. It was more sluggish. I really don't like it nearly as much as the Stage 4. I was going to keep my Stage 3 to have an 88 note board, but now I'm spoiled by the Stage 4 and will sell the Stage 3. These two products do not have the same keybed! The Stage 4 is noticeably better.

dansnord wrote:These two products do not have the same keybed! The Stage 4 is noticeably better.
Thats correct, the Stage 4 has a triple sensor action while NS3 has a dual sensor action. Repeats and thrills are easier on a triple sensor keybed. https://www.nordkeyboards.com/products/ ... ison-chart
